MEGAsquirt A place to collectively sort out this megasquirt gizmo

EBC Mac valve issues DIYPNP( not cycling)

Thread Tools
 
Search this Thread
 
Old 09-15-2019, 09:50 AM
  #1  
Newb
Thread Starter
 
Quarkie's Avatar
 
Join Date: Nov 2017
Location: Holland. Noord brabant
Posts: 30
Total Cats: 2
Default EBC Mac valve issues DIYPNP( not cycling)

Hi all. I'm going to provide as many details on this as i can to help this get a bit easier.I've read and read, but can't figure this out

So a while ago, i installed a mac valve on my miata.
12V is taken from the blue connector under the hood, and the ground is taken from the megasquirt.(PA0)
The solenoid is connected trough a switch in the car, between the ebc and the megasquirt.I can hear a click when i flip the switch so it's getting 12V.

I blew trough it in both position.With the ebc closed i can blow trough it (wastegate pressure works perfectly fine), and when open i can't. So i can rule that out also.
I've read to setup open loop first, to make closed loop a it easier. But even the open loop is not doing anything, so i assume the valve is not doing anything other then powering on and off

When i select the output test mode, i can cycle the valve and clearly hear it pumping( both on 19hz and 39hz)
In this case i assume, there is indeed something going wrong with the valve, since it works in test mode, but not when i set it up in the boost bias table.
The settings are on inverted, if i put it on normal, the switch doesn't do anything, so that's setup correctly also.
As far as i understood, the valve should cycle, even with the engine off , at a certain tps position ( correct me if i'm wrong)

At first i got the conflict 'boost in already in use, (but that was just because the pinout was active in the outputs,AND in the boost setting screen) so that is not the issue.
i used the tip in this post ( https://www.miataturbo.net/megasquirt-18/ebc-pos-46521/ ) and followed this tip below:

it's obviously operating the valve if it's grounding it out to make you go into overboost. But to check operation, turn it to open-loop mode and then set the table's lowest RPM to 100RPM. Then make it run at 50% DC. At idle you should be about to hear it rapidly clicking if you get your head near it, you'll never hear it otherwise.
you need to make sure your open/closed % are the wastegate valves not the EBC solenoid.
So it needs to be open = 0% and closed = 100% and then set it to inverted.
You should be able to put 250 into P, if not, I dunno what your deal is.
(The above was a post from Braineack in that thread )

I got the solenoid working one time by doing that.Now i have no idea why i cannot reproduce this.
No matter what number i put into the duty table, it wont cycle at idle

When i flip the switch to just wastgate pressure, it holds a steady psi.
When i flip it to activate the boost solenoid, it doesn't go into overboost in a 3d or 4th gear pull, and doesnt feel any different.
I tried to put both the duty at 0 and 100, and everything in between.
Changing pid settings doesn't help either.
Does anyone has a clue to as why it's showing this weird behaviour?

Feel free to ask any additional info , i like to get this ebc working cause i dont want have fluctuating boost when the temps change
Quarkie is offline  
Old 09-23-2019, 04:34 PM
  #2  
Newb
Thread Starter
 
Quarkie's Avatar
 
Join Date: Nov 2017
Location: Holland. Noord brabant
Posts: 30
Total Cats: 2
Default

Well guys, i got my mac valve working.. I just swapped the nipples around . The wastegate was connected to port 1 and the compressor outlet to port 3, and now they're connected to port 2 and 3 .
Now i can finally set up my closed loop boost control. Its building 10 psi at open loop right now
Quarkie is offline  
Related Topics
Thread
Thread Starter
Forum
Replies
Last Post
icantlearn
MEGAsquirt
6
11-15-2016 01:26 PM
deezums
MEGAsquirt
59
05-18-2015 07:58 PM
ronniebiggs
MEGAsquirt
59
04-18-2012 05:03 PM
ubenpdon
MEGAsquirt
21
05-03-2010 12:18 AM
miatauser884
General Miata Chat
9
11-10-2009 05:56 PM



Quick Reply: EBC Mac valve issues DIYPNP( not cycling)



All times are GMT -4. The time now is 12:04 AM.